When did Horace Grant start wearing goggles?

He helped Chicago win three consecutive NBA championships (1991, 1992, and 1993), securing the third with a last-second block on Kevin Johnson. Grant, who was diagnosed with myopia and wore eyeglasses, began wearing goggles fitted with prescription lenses on the court starting with the 1990–91 season.

Why did Horace Grant have goggles?

The NBA champion explained that he became legally blind in one eye earlier in his career while playing for the Chcago Bulls. Under the advisement of Bulls medical staff, the power forward who also spent time as a member of the Los Angeles Lakers, Orlando Magic and Seattle Sonics wore goggles.

Why did James Worthy wear glasses?

It was also in 1985 that Worthy first donned goggles after suffering a scratched cornea during a March 13 game at the Utah Jazz, wearing them for the rest of his career.

When did Hakeem Olajuwon wear goggles?

1, 1993 (what a way to start off the New Year), Hakeem Olajuwon was nailed in the face by an elbow from Bill Cartwright. Hakeem has sustained a fractured right orbit, which is the bone that sits around the eye. After nearly two months away from the game of basketball, Olajuwon returned and was sporting goggles.

Why did Kareem change his name?

Having converted to Islam while at UCLA, Alcindor took the Arabic name Kareem Abdul-Jabbar in 1971. In 1975 he was traded to the Los Angeles Lakers, who won the NBA championship in 1980, 1982, 1985, 1987, and 1988.
